What are common Subaru repair issues for drivers in the Tehuacana area?

Given the rural roads and potential for dusty conditions around Tehuacana, common issues include premature wear on suspension components, CV joint boots, and air filters. Subarus are also known for head gasket issues in older models (like the Outback and Forester) and oil consumption in certain 4-cylinder engines, which are important to monitor regardless of local conditions.

How do local driving conditions affect when I should seek Subaru service?

The mix of farm-to-market roads, occasional rough terrain, and hot Texas climate means your Subaru's all-wheel-drive system, cooling system, and tires should be checked more frequently. It's advisable to have a pre-summer cooling system check and to inspect the AWD system and undercarriage more often than recommended if you frequently drive on unpaved or poorly maintained local roads.

Are there any local considerations for maintaining my Subaru in Tehuacana?

Yes, the local climate and environment are key. The intense heat can accelerate battery failure and stress cooling systems, so regular checks are crucial. Furthermore, dust and agricultural debris can clog engine air filters and cabin air filters faster, so inspect and replace them more frequently than the standard schedule to protect your engine and interior air quality.
